According to the US National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health (NIOSH):
  • Allergic reactions    are    among the most common conditions that adversely affect the health    of personnel    involved    in    the    care and use of    animals    in research.
  • Symptoms of    allergies include sneezing,    nasal congestion, itchy eyes and cough.
  • Some personnel may even    develop    asthma or other respiratory disorders.
  • Personnel should protect themselves from exposure to animals and animal    products.
  • Seek medical attention in case allergy symptoms develop.
